Let me direct you to Article 5 ("Trustees"), Section 1 ("Powers"): |
14 |
|
15 |
"The business and affairs of the foundation shall be managed by or under |
16 |
the direction of the Board of Trustees, the "Trustees", which may exercise |
17 |
all such powers of the foundation and do all such lawful acts and things as |
18 |
are not by statute or by the Certificate of Incorporation or by these |
19 |
Bylaws specifically reserved to the members." |
20 |
|
21 |
^^^^^^^ |
22 |
|
23 |
I think I may need to insert some asterisks. The Trustees may exercise |
24 |
**all such powers of the foundation**. Which powers? **all powers**. What |
25 |
lawful acts, **all such lawful acts and things as are not by statute or by |
26 |
the Certificate of Incorporation or by these Bylaws specifically reserved |
27 |
for the members.** Let me clarify here that "statute" means "written law", |
28 |
so in other words, GLEP 37 is not a statute. |
29 |
|
30 |
What this means is that while a Council system exists, this is with the |
31 |
consent of the Trustees, and its existence does not in any way diminish the |
32 |
authority of the Trustees over the project. |
33 |
|
34 |
What the Trustees *cannot* do is ignore what is in the Bylaws, which means |
35 |
that they are elected by members, and that their positions have a term, etc. |
